0:00Australian values get thrown around a lot in politics these days, especially around immigration. Folks rally on Australia Day pushing for tighter controls, framing it as protecting fairness and a fair go for everyone. But lately, that talk feels loaded, turning what should be simple decency into a test for who belongs. Back in the 90s, Pauline Hansen's first speech in Parliament sparked big debates, warning about cultural shifts from migration. It hit classrooms and communities hard, making people question if those values really include everyone, or just been to fit certain views. For many with migrant roots, like those from Sri Lanka or Asia, it stings personally. They grew up code switching accents at work, or feeling side-minded in discussions, wondering if they're fully in or out of the Australian picture. Now, with rallies popping up nationwide, the conversation keeps evolving. Officials and leaders stress respect inequality, but critics say it's becoming a checklist that some must prove while others judge. At its core, true values like a fair go,
